GDP edges higher in January 
  GDP edges higher in January MARCH 30, 2012 Gross domestic product was up 0.1 per cent in January. OTTAWA — Canada's economic growth slowed in January as gains in the manufacturing sector were partly offset by a drop in oil and gas extraction, Statistics Canada said Friday. Gross domestic product was up 0.1 per cent during the month, the federal... more »

Bank of Canada holds steady on rates 
  Bank of Canada holds steady on rates, cites uncertainty Eric Lam Jan 17, 2012 The Bank of Canada kept its key interest rate at 1% for the 11th time in row on Tuesday as the Canadian economy remains a mixed bag with a strong close to 2011 overshadowed by weaker prospects at home and abroad in... more »
